Last Thursday, Speaker of the House Nancy Pelosi, third in line to the Presidency and currently the highest ranking Democrat on Planet Earth, sat down for an 80-minute chat with reporters and editorial board members of her home district's San Francisco Chronicle. 62 minutes in, Madame Speaker, pontificating on the Iraq surge, offered up the following:

"Whatever the military success and any progress that may have been made, the surge didn't accomplish its goal. ... And some of the success of the surge is that the goodwill of the Iranians -- they decided in Basra when the fighting would end, they negotiated that cessation of hostilities -- the Iranians."

On September 26, 2007, Limbaugh was on his syndicated show discussing Jesse Macbeth, a disgraced Army Ranger candidate who flunked out of boot camp and later rose to liberal media prominence by telling tall tales of atrocities he and other soldiers were supposed to have committed in Iraq.

Macbeth of course had never been there. The media of course had not checked out Macbeth's story or his biography. His lies fit their Mesopotamian template, so they ran with them, only to later again appear the fools when the truth about their unexamined source came to light.

With Limbaugh, the press took a single two word phrase, "phony soldiers" -- which he had correctly used in reference to Macbeth and others like him who had similarly risen to media prominence -- and went nuts, twisting and contorting the specificity of Limbaugh's comment into a bogus broad-based slur of any American combatant opposed to the war.
